Abstract

Aims: To evaluate the eect of three dierent adhesive syems on shear bond rength of composite resin to Er,Cr:YSGG lased dentin. Materials and methods: Twenty one sound third molars were used. Occlusal third of crowns was cut using minitom machine to expose at dentin surface. Laser irradiation was performed on a circular te area demarcated on each dentin surface. Samples randomly assigned to three groups (n=7) according to the adhesive syems that used which were: total etch adhesive (Adper single bond, 3M ESPE), two ep self etch adhesive (Clearl SE bond, Kurary), and all in one adhesive (Adper easy one, 3M ESPE). Adhesives were applied to the lased dentin surface according to manufacture inruction. Composite rod was applied over the bonded area and cured. Samples were ored in diilled water at 370for 24 hours. The evaluation of shear bond rength was employed by the use of universal teing machine. Results: Statiical analysis of data by analysis of variance (ANOVA) te and Duncanes multiple range te revealed no signicant dierence in the shear bond rength between the adhesive syems (P 0.05). Conclusions: The results show that all the teed adhesive syems have relatively the same eect on the shear bond rength of composite resin to lased dentin surface.
